Time Limits

In many states, asbestos patients have a limited time to file a mesothelioma suit. These laws are known as statutes of limitations and they set deadlines for filing personal injury or wrongful death claim. A mesothelioma lawyer can help patients and families determine the time limit that applies to their case. The applicable statute can depend on a range of factors such as the victim's place of residence and work. It may also differ in relation to the location where exposure to asbestos occurred and what asbestos companies or job sites are involved.

Typically, the statute of limitations "clock" begins when a person realized or should have known that exposure to asbestos resulted in serious injuries. For mesothelioma patients, this is typically the date of diagnosis. In some cases the clock can begin earlier. The clock could start earlier if, for instance the patient suffers from a chronic illness, such as asthma, which requires constant medication, and limits their activity.

Lastly, a national mesothelioma lawyer can assist you in filing claims for compensation from asbestos trust funds. Asbestos companies that are responsible for asbestos exposure were reorganized under Chapter 11 bankruptcy laws and established trusts to pay mesothelioma patients. A mesothelioma lawyer who is knowledgeable has an extensive database of trust funds and can help you file an action for compensation.
